Complications

Stopping or improperly taking medication can lead to symptoms coming back and the following complications:

* Alcohol and/or drug abuse may be used as a strategy to "self-medicate."
* Personal relationships, work, and finances may suffer as a result of mood swings.
* Suicidal thoughts and behaviors are a very real complication of bipolar disorder.

This illness is challenging to treat. Patients and their friends and family must be aware of the risks of neglecting to treat bipolar disorder.
